Ritratto (2024) is this intriguing blend of documentary and drama, yet it feels oddly personal. The film dives into the life of a young man who seems to be trapped in his own world, isolated and contemplative. The pacing is deliberate, almost meditative, which really lets you sink into his thoughts and emotions. The use of practical effects is minimal but effectively enhances the atmosphere, adding layers to his solitude. Performances feel raw and authentic, drawing you into his internal struggles. What sets this one apart is its semi-fictional approach, blurring the lines between reality and fiction, which leaves you questioning what's truly real. It’s definitely a unique watch.
